Obituary for Debra Lou Hess

On Tuesday, May 11th, 2021, Debra Lou Hess (Debbie) widowed, loving mother and grandmother passed away at the age of 64.

Debbie was born on November 15th, 1956 in Mullens WV to Warren and Vadis Miller, both of which proceeded her in death. Debbie is the second youngest of four siblings. Debbie’s sister Tamara Jo Miller and brother Donald Gene Miller also proceeded Debbie in death.

Debbie and her sister Carol Garrett moved to Manassas Virginia in 1976 where she would call home for much of her life marrying Earl Carlis Hess in 1985 and having two children, Earl “Shawn” Hess and Tamisha Quantrell Hess (Mimi). Earl Carlis Hess, loving husband and father left this earth in the year 1991.

Debbie enjoyed many things in life such as playing Bingo or visiting Casino’s, but nothing gave her more enjoyment and happiness than her grandchildren. Debbie loved them more than life itself. She would often say “I love them so much it hurts”. You could hear the joy in her voice just by talking with them over the phone.

Debbie is survived by her two children, Shawn & Tamisha Hess and Shawn’s wife Crystal, whom Debbie thought of as one of her own children, her sister Carol Garrett, five grandchildren, Christopher Steven Hall, Carleigh Renee Hall, Trinity Rachelle Hess, Brielle Wynter Hess and Lucas Jaxson Hess. Debbie is also survived by Nieces, Nephews and Cousins.
